This n8n workflow automates security vulnerability management by integrating Slack with Qualys, enabling users to initiate scans, generate reports, and manage vulnerabilities directly from Slack. The workflow begins with a webhook trigger that captures Slack interactions, such as button clicks or modal submissions. It includes nodes for parsing incoming webhook data, routing messages based on callback IDs, and presenting interactive modals for user input.

Key steps include:

– Opening modals for vulnerability scan initiation and report generation, with input fields for scan options, asset groups, and report details.

– Collecting user input and routing it accordingly.

– Triggering sub-workflows to start vulnerability scans or create reports using Qualys API.

– Responding back to Slack with confirmation or report links.
